What is the Shetland Council Tax Discount Application?
The Shetland Council Tax Discount Application is a vital form designed for residents of the Shetland Islands to apply for a 25% discount on their council tax. Eligibility Criteria for the Shetland Council Tax Discount Application
Eligibility for the 25% council tax discount requires meeting specific criteria. Applicants must reside in the Shetland Islands and fulfill at least one of the following requirements:
-
Be a single adult occupant of the property.
-
Live with someone who is considered disregarded for council tax purposes (e.g., student, under 18).
-
Have a disability that necessitates additional room adjustments.
Understanding these criteria is essential for residents looking to benefit from the Shetland Islands tax exemption.
